云服务器

ubnutu系统我们不多见的一个linux系统种类之一,我们只使用过配置过程中用到sudo这个命令的地方比较多,在使用ubnutu系统安装后,系统不会设置root用户的密码,而是叫你新建一个用户来设置密码,而新建的用户往往由于权限不足在使用一些命令时候会出现不能执行或者是只用只读的权限。所以我们这是后需要用sodu命令来完成和获得操作权限。

就例如我们在安装系统后用我们新建的那个用户帮主机设置IP这个操作,通常我们设置IP都是用VI /etc/network/inteerfaces 进入后编辑添加静态ip等操作。当我们在保存的时候他就会出现这样的一个提示: E45:readonly option is set (add! to override) 。


从提示中我们知道这个意思是告诉我们,我们对于这个文件只用只读权限,没有写入和更改的权限。

所以这里我们就需要用的sudo vi /etc/network/inteerfaces 这个命令来打开这个文件。这样我们就不出现无法修改文件的问题了。

类似这样的情况还会出现在如我们需要关闭防火墙等操作上:关闭防火墙命令是 ufw disable

但是如果用户不是root那么就会提示权限问题。


那么如果我们加上sudo那么就可以正常关闭了。


所以总结下,在ubnubt系统中sudo命令是一个需要我们掌握的一个命令。

提交成功!非常感谢您的反馈,我们会继续努力做到更好!

这条文档是否有帮助解决问题?

非常抱歉未能帮助到您。为了给您提供更好的服务,我们很需要您进一步的反馈信息:

在文档使用中是否遇到以下问题: